1. TOP PICK — SMOTURE Cordless Vacuum Cleaner, 650W / 55KPa (70 Min Runtime)

Best for: Pet owners, small apartments, car detailing

This SMOTURE 650W, 55KPa cordless model aims for whole-home reach. It lists up to 70 minutes of runtime on low. The package includes a pet brush, sofa brush, and a 3.3-foot hose. Wall-mount charging helps keep the stick off the floor and ready.

On hard floors, pickup feels quick with the high airflow path. I like the hose for above-floor areas and car interiors. The pet brush helps pull fur from blankets and dog beds. For larger messes, boost power and short bursts do the trick.

2. BEST QUALITY — SMOTURE 650W Cordless Vacuum with LED Touchscreen

Best for: Families with long hair, gadget lovers, mixed-floor homes

This 650W SMOTURE adds an LED touchscreen and an anti-tangle head. The screen shows battery and mode at a glance. Anti-tangle combs help reduce hair wraps on the brush. The design supports floors, rugs, stairs, and quick spot cleanups.

In daily use, the touchscreen is handy. I can see battery percent and swap modes with a tap. The anti-tangle bar helps in homes with long hair or shedding dogs. Suction is strong on grit, cereal, and cat litter.

3. RECOMMENDED — 550W Cordless Vacuum, 2 Batteries, 110-Min Runtime

Best for: Large homes, mixed floors, busy schedules

This 550W stick includes two batteries and a brushless motor. The listing claims up to 110 minutes combined runtime in low mode. It also features auto suction adjustment. That helps balance power and battery as floor types change.

In practice, two batteries remove the biggest pain: mid-session charging. I finish large areas without waiting. Auto mode helps on mixed floors, lifting power on rugs, easing up on tile. It feels like a smarter clean with less thought.

FAQs — SMOTURE Cordless Vacuum Reviews

How long do SMOTURE batteries last per charge?

Most list up to 70 minutes on low. High power cuts that down. Actual time depends on floor type and mode.

Do SMOTURE vacuums work on high-pile carpet?

They can, but performance varies. Use max suction for short passes. Auto mode helps, yet deep plush may slow the head.

Are replacement filters and batteries easy to find?

Yes, they are usually available online. Check your exact model number. Keep a spare filter for best airflow.

Which SMOTURE is best for pet hair?

The 650W models with anti-tangle or pet brushes work best. Look for brush bars with combs. Strong suction helps lift fur fast.

Do I need a wall mount or a dock?
